The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of Robert Helps, born in 1812 in Ditcheat, Somerset, consisted of 4 members. Robert was the head of the household, married to Jane Helps, born in 1823 in Glastonbury, Somerset, England.
During the period, also present in the household were Robert's Step Son, Sidney (born 1865 in West Pennard, Somerset, England) and Robert's Step Son, George (born 1868 in West Pennard, Somerset, England).
